    This highlights very succinctly the devastatingly thin line we must walk when we discuss whether sex work is feminist or not.

    I know from various online communities that there are sex workers out there who love their job, have had other opportunities and still have chosen their path, and feel they could get out without any harm (physical, socioeconomic, etc) coming to them. But I also know that there are people who have been forced, pressured, or, like in the article, have had no other choice. When societies choose to make sex work a legal enterprise, capitalism just won't cut it. It needs to be regulated, planned for, and there need to be services available for these workers (women AND men) who can very easily be put in a vulnerable position.
